Bitcoin is increasingly viewed as a legitimate means of exchange. Many well-known companies accept Bitcoin payments, although most partner with an exchange to convert Bitcoin into U.S. dollars before receiving their funds.

Many lesser-used cryptocurrencies can only be exchanged through private, peer-to-peer transfers, meaning they’re not very liquid and are hard to value relative to other currencies — both crypto- and fiat.

SafeMoon today trades around 0.0000027 a coin with a market capitalization of about US$1.6 billion, sharply lower than its high of almost US$6 billion in mid-May, according to CoinMarketCap.
